Browse Source

修复换装ui层级错乱的问题

guodong 1 year ago
parent
commit
20d38b4ebc
1 changed files with 6 additions and 1 deletions
  1. 6 1
      GameClient/Assets/Game/HotUpdate/DressUp/DressUpUtil.cs

+ 6 - 1
GameClient/Assets/Game/HotUpdate/DressUp/DressUpUtil.cs

@@ -505,7 +505,12 @@ namespace GFGGame
                     renderer.sortingOrder = sortingOrder;
                 }
             }
-
+            var spritesRenderers = gameObj.transform.GetComponentsInChildren<SpriteRenderer>();
+            for(int i = 0; i < spritesRenderers.Length; i++)
+            {
+                var spriteRender = spritesRenderers[i];
+                spriteRender.sortingOrder = sortingOrder;
+            }
         }
 
         public static List<int> GetSuitItems(int suitId, bool isAction, int[] excludeType = null, bool showOptional = true, bool CheckOwn = true)